Righteousness is the adherance to moral, or virtuous, principles. But who is the determiner of the moral principle? Our culture proclaims falsely that what may be right (just, righteous) to one group/individual is not necessarily right for another group/individual. There is, however, a standard of absolute morality - and that standard has been determined by God and proclaimed in His Law. Hence, True Righteousness is that which is right according to God's standards. True justice is that justice which is enacted according to the righteous principles of God's law. Righteousness and justice are the foundation of God's throne. God's righteousness is integral to His judgment and our salvation. This message was presented on Sunday, June 27, 2010 by Bob Corbin
